Step 1
Preheat oven to 350°F. Line a 9×9 inch baking pan with parchment paper and set aside.*Note that if using foil the edges may brown/crisp quicker.
Step 2
In a large bowl combine the butter and brown sugar. Beat in the egg and vanilla extract until mixture is smooth.
Step 3
Add flour and salt and gently stir until incorporated. Fold in the white chocolate chips and sprinkles.
Step 4
Spoon the dough into the baking pan, spreading it into an even layer.
Step 5
Bake for 17 - 18 minutes. DO NOT over bake.*Bars are done when the edges and the very top layer is set and the center is soft and under baked.
Step 6
Cool in pan for at least 20 minutes before slicing. Serve warm or cooled completely.
